Case Summary: SLP(Crl) No. 009116/2008 - N. Sudhakaran v. T.P. Hari On 12/12/2008, the Supreme Court of India (Justices Arijit Pasayat and Mukundakam Sharma) heard N. Sudhakaran's special leave petition challenging a Kerala High Court order from 20/07/2004. The Court dismissed the petition on two grounds: an unexplained delay of over 1400 days in filing the SLP and lack of merit in the petition itself.
